.store-map__layout{display:flex;gap:4rem;align-items:center;background:#fff;flex-direction:column}.store-map-section{overflow:hidden}@media screen and (min-width:750px){.store-map__layout{gap:0!important;flex-direction:row;align-items:start;justify-content:center}.store-map__map-col{height:550px}.store-map__image img{height:550px!important;object-fit:cover}.store-map__layout.store-map__layout--map-left{flex-direction:row}.store-map__info-col{flex:none;min-width:370px!important;width:370px!important;padding:50px 60px!important}}.store-map__embed iframe,.store-map__embed{width:100%;aspect-ratio:4 / 3;display:block;border:none}.store-map__image{display:flex}.store-map__image img{width:100%;height:auto}.store-map__placeholder{width:100%;aspect-ratio:4 / 3;background:#f0efed;display:flex;align-items:center;justify-content:center}.store-map__placeholder .placeholder-svg{width:60px;opacity:.3}.store-map__info-col{display:flex;flex-direction:column;gap:0;padding:25px 25px 0;max-width:370px}.store-map__heading{font-size:22px;letter-spacing:.2em;text-transform:uppercase;color:#000;margin-top:0;margin-bottom:1.2em}.store-map__block{margin:0}.store-map__address p,.store-map__hours p,.store-map__text p{font-size:1.3rem;color:#000;font-family:Nunito,sans-serif;font-weight:400;font-style:normal;margin-top:0}.store-map__btn{display:inline-block;padding:12px 28px;font-size:1.2rem;font-weight:500;letter-spacing:.12em;text-transform:uppercase;border:1.5px solid #000;color:#000;background:transparent;text-decoration:none;transition:background .25s ease,color .25s ease}.store-map__btn:hover{background:#000;color:#fff}.store-map__info-col--center{align-items:center;text-align:center}@media screen and (max-width:749px){.store-map__layout{gap:2.4rem}}@media screen and (max-width:749px){.store-map__layout{gap:2.4rem}.store-map__info-col{order:1}.store-map__map-col{order:2}}@media screen and (min-width:750px){.store-map__layout--map-right .store-map__map-col{order:2}.store-map__layout--map-right .store-map__info-col{order:1}}@media screen and (min-width:990px){.store-map__layout{max-width:1150px;margin:0 auto}}
/*# sourceMappingURL=/cdn/shop/t/33/assets/section-map.css.map */
